Recommended Brake System Maintenance Frequency

The frequency of brake system maintenance varies based on several factors, including manufacturer guidelines and the type of vehicle. Generally, most manufacturers recommend inspecting the brake system every 10,000 to 15,000 miles, which aligns with the overall vehicle service schedule.

Different vehicles may have distinct requirements influenced by their design and purpose. For instance, heavy-duty vehicles or those used for towing might require more frequent maintenance due to increased wear on the brake components. Regular checks help ensure optimal performance and safety.

Environmental conditions also play a significant role in determining maintenance frequency. For vehicles operating in hilly or mountainous regions, brakes may experience more strain, necessitating more regular inspections. In contrast, vehicles driven primarily on highways might require less frequent maintenance.

Manufacturer Guidelines

Manufacturer guidelines provide specific recommendations regarding brake system maintenance frequency, outlining necessary intervals based on the vehicle’s design and braking technology. Adhering to these guidelines can enhance safety and efficiency.

Typically, manufacturers advise following a maintenance schedule that includes routine inspections and servicing. Common intervals recommended are:

  • Every 10,000 to 15,000 miles for brake pads.
  • Every 20,000 to 30,000 miles for brake fluid replacement.
  • Annual inspections for the entire brake system.

These recommendations may vary depending on the vehicle type and usage conditions. Regularly consulting the owner’s manual ensures compliance with the manufacturer’s specifications and prolongs brake system lifespan.

General Timeline for Different Vehicles

The general timeline for brake system maintenance varies depending on the vehicle type and usage conditions. For standard passenger vehicles, a regular inspection is recommended every 6,000 to 10,000 miles. This frequency allows for addressing common issues such as brake pad wear.

In contrast, heavier vehicles, like trucks and SUVs, may require checks every 5,000 miles due to the increased stress on their braking systems. Additionally, vehicles regularly used for towing or off-road driving should have even more frequent maintenance to ensure optimal brake performance.

Luxury and high-performance cars often incorporate advanced brake technologies that may necessitate specialized maintenance at intervals outlined by the manufacturer, usually between 10,000 to 15,000 miles. Adhering to these guidelines is essential for maintaining safety and performance.

Factors Affecting Brake System Maintenance Frequency

Numerous factors influence brake system maintenance frequency, and understanding them is essential for vehicle safety and performance. Driving conditions play a prominent role; vehicles regularly subjected to stop-and-go traffic or hilly terrains may require more frequent maintenance than those used primarily on highways.

Vehicle type also significantly impacts maintenance intervals. Heavy-duty vehicles, such as trucks, often experience accelerated wear due to their weight and operational demands, necessitating more frequent checks compared to lighter passenger cars.

Additionally, driving habits can affect brake system wear. Aggressive driving styles, which involve rapid acceleration and sudden braking, lead to quicker deterioration of brake components. Regular inspections are advised for such drivers to ensure optimal performance and safety.

Lastly, environmental factors, such as exposure to corrosive elements or harsh weather conditions, can further influence maintenance frequency. This highlights the necessity for tailored maintenance schedules based on individual circumstances and driving behaviors.

Signs That Indicate the Need for Brake Maintenance

Recognizing signs that indicate the need for brake maintenance is vital for ensuring safety on the road. Certain symptoms serve as alert signals for drivers, suggesting that regular brake system maintenance frequency may need to be prioritized.

Common indicators include unusual noises such as squeaking, grinding, or screeching sounds when braking, signaling worn-out brake pads. Furthermore, a soft or spongy brake pedal can indicate issues with brake fluid levels or air in the brake lines, necessitating immediate attention.

Vibrations or pulsations felt in the brake pedal during braking are also critical warnings. This may suggest warped brake rotors, which require professional assessment. Additionally, a noticeable increase in stopping distance points to deteriorating brake performance. Such signs demand timely intervention to prevent potential accidents and ensure reliable vehicle operation.

Types of Brake System Services

Brake system services encompass various procedures aimed at maintaining and enhancing the performance of a vehicle’s braking mechanisms. These services are critical in ensuring safety and efficiency while driving.

Routine brake inspections serve as a foundational service, offering a thorough evaluation of brake components such as pads, rotors, and fluid levels. This assessment helps to identify wear and tear before it becomes critical.

Brake pad replacement is another essential service, as pads wear down over time and compromise braking efficiency. Regular replacement, based on usage and manufacturer recommendations, is vital for safe vehicle operation.

Brake fluid flushing and replacement are also crucial services, ensuring that the brake hydraulic system operates effectively. Contaminated brake fluid can lead to brake failure, underscoring the importance of adhering to recommended maintenance frequency.

Basic Inspections

Basic inspections of the brake system are critical to ensuring the vehicle’s safety and reliability. Regular checks help identify any potential issues before they escalate into more significant problems, which can lead to expensive repairs or dangerous driving situations.

Start by examining the brake pads for wear. If the pads appear thin or unevenly worn, they may need replacement. Additionally, inspect the brake rotors for any signs of scoring or warping, as these imperfections can affect braking performance. Look for any fluid leaks around the brake lines and master cylinder, which could signal a critical failure.

Checking the brake fluid level is also important; low fluid can indicate a leak or worn brake pads. Ensure that the brake warning light on the dashboard functions properly, as it may alert you to underlying problems.

When to Seek Professional Help

Identifying when to seek professional help for brake system maintenance is critical for vehicle safety. If you observe any unusual noises, such as grinding or squeaking, it is imperative to consult a qualified mechanic. These sounds often indicate worn brake pads or other significant issues requiring expert attention.

Additionally, if your vehicle exhibits inconsistent braking performance, such as pulling to one side or experiencing a delayed response, professional evaluation is essential. Such symptoms could suggest problems with the brake caliper or other integral components of the brake system.

Another important moment to seek professional assistance is if you notice a drop in your brake fluid level or find any fluid leaks. These situations can lead to diminished braking effectiveness, making it crucial to address the concerns promptly through expert intervention.
